#a4f50d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a4f50d is composed of 64.3% red, 96.1%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 80.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 50.6%. #a4f50d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1a with #49eb00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ff00.

#a4f50d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a4f50d has RGB values of R:164, G:245,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 10810637.

Shades and Tints of #a4f50d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020300 is the darkest color, while #f9feef is the lightest one.

Tones of #a4f50d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848a78 is the less saturated color, while #a7ff03 is the most saturated one.
